~These are a family favorite, called Blue Ribbon Specials~
Ingredients:
3/4 cup unsalted butter
4 tablespoons butter flavored shortening
1 1/2 cups light brown sugar
1/2 cup baking coco
2 large eggs
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 1/3 cups flour
1 teaspoon salt
1 1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1 1/4 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
1 cup milk chocolate covered toffee baking bits
Directions:
Combine flour, baking soda, coco and salt into a small bowl. Whisk dry ingredients together and set mixture aside. Cut butter into cubes and mix in a large bowl until soft. Slowly add sugar and blend, making sure that you scrape the sides of the bowl with a spatula. Whisk eggs and vanilla together, slowly add to butter mixture. Slowly add dry ingredients mixing at a low speed. By hand mix in chocolate chips and toffee. Form dough into small, golf ball sized balls, place in freezer to chill. Once the dough has chilled remove from freezer and place on cookie sheet. Place in the oven at 350 degrees for 10-11 minutes. Recipe makes 3 dozen.
